  2. Running a 3-ton central air or mini-split air conditioner will use anywhere between 1.44 kWh and 2.57 kWh per hour (depends on the SEER rating). If you run a 3-ton AC for 8 hours, you will use anywhere from 11.5 kWh to 20.6 kWh of electricity.

Based on ‘Duration Of Air Conditioner Use Per Day’ study by Statista, most people run an air conditioner between 3 and 6 hours per day (41% of respondents). 25% of respondents said they run an air conditioner between 1 and 3 hours per day, and 34% of respondents said they run their AC for more than 7 hours per day.   4. Feb 11, 2024 · On average, a 2-ton (24000 BTU) AC unit will use around 1.5 kWh of energy per hour of use. Assuming it is left on for 8 hours a day, a 2-ton air conditioner will consume around 12 kWh of energy daily, which equates to about 360 kWh of energy per month.

  8. Jul 22, 2022 · An air conditioner needs between 15 and 30 minutes run time to completely cool and dehumidify the indoor air, and over time, the structure and items within your home. Specific run-time depends on the outdoor temperature, the size of your home, and insulation.
